WOODBRIDGE, Va. — At 5:45 p.m. Sunday, Occoquan-Woodbridge-Lorton Volunteer Firefighters responded to the report of a person who had fallen out of a kayak in the Occoquan Reservoir.

Medic 514 and Engine 514 arrived on the scene and made visual contact with the victim from the nearest shore. Fortunately the victim’s mother and another Good Samaritan had come to his aid and had pulled the child from the water into a canoe.

OCCOQUAN, Va. — The owner of Prince William Marina – one of the most successful boat retailers in the nation – is recovering from a boat fire Thursday night.

Insidenova.com reported marina-owner Carlton Phillips suffered second degree burns while using acetone to clean a boat in the marina’s service bay. The boat caught fire, and Phillips was taken to a hospital.

FAIRFAX COUNTY, Va. — Mark Gibson – independent candidate for Virginia’s 11th Congressional District (VA-11) – received confirmation from the Federal Election Commission (FEC) that it received and processed his principal campaign committee’s Statement of Organization, known as FEC Form 1.

Gibson’s committee will now file regular financial reports that contain all receipts and disbursements by the committee as required under the Federal Election Campaign Act. These reports can be accessed by the public at www.fec.gov/finance/disclosure/imaging_help.shtml. Though not mandatory, Gibson voluntarily posts near-real-time campaign expenditures and donations under the “Finances” link of his website – www.Gibson4congress2012.com.

DUMFRIES, Va. — The Prince William County Children’s Choir will begin its first season this fall for children ages five to 12-years-old.

Founder and Music Director Amanda Long will hold auditions August 25 and 25, and September 8 and 9. Participants are not required to have any music training to audition, only be able to read. Audition registration will open on August 10 and the choir has space for up to 60 participants for the first year; the first rehearsal will be held September 15.

WOODBRIDGE, Va. — An upgrade to the phone system at the Potomac and Rappahannock Transportation Commission provides riders easier access to vital travel information without having to wait to personally speak with a Customer Service Agent.

The upgraded phone system saves some passengers from waiting on hold to speak with PRTC staff and enables PRTC Customer Service Agents to devote more time to callers who need individualized attention.

Rape / Aggravated Sexual Battery – On July 10th at 1:26PM, detectives from the Special Victims Bureau began an investigation into a sexual assault which was reported to have occurred at two addresses in Woodbridge (22192) – one on Rainbow Ct and the other on Bancroft Ln. The investigation revealed that the victim, a now 34 year old woman of Gainesville, was sexually assaulted by the accused, a known acquaintance, in the 1990’s when she was between 5 & 19 years of age. Following an investigation, the accused was subsequently arrested on July 25th.
